National Capital Private Hospital is a modern, progressive, acute surgical, medical and rehabilitation hospital of 148 beds located in the southern suburbs of Canberra. The hospital has 8 operating theatres, an intensive care unit, coronary care unit, day surgery unit, medical/rehabilitation and surgical wards. We provide services to patients from the ACT and southern NSW.

Your role will involve:

· Providing a social work service which includes timely assessments, counselling, education and discharge planning and referral with patients and their support networks

· Liaising with the multidisciplinary team and external service providers

· A high level of communication with colleagues, patients and their carers, and the medical teams

· Prioritisation and management of clinical caseload and close communication with social worker colleague

· Supervision with senior Social Worker and a commitment to ongoing professional development.

Selection Criteria:

· Appropriate tertiary qualifications in Social Work

· Member of the Australian Association of Social Workers (or eligibility for the same)

· Minimum of 2 years clinical experience

· Demonstrated knowledge of and ability to provide a high level of skilled clinical social work services in an inpatient hospital setting, including assessments, interventions, counselling, discharge planning and referral.

· Demonstrated ability to work autonomously and collaboratively with multidisciplinary teams and prioritise workload according to clinical indicators and organisational requirements.

· Demonstrated ability to participate in and provide social work supervision that adheres to the AASW Practice Standards and to engage in and deliver team education, for both staff and social work students.

· Well-developed communication skills and interpersonal skills and a demonstrated ability to liaise with service providers and external community agencies and groups.

· Demonstrated excellent organisation, time management and self-management skills.

· Demonstrated commitment to ongoing education and the provision of evidence based practice.

Healthscope is Australia's only national private hospital operation and healthcare provider with a network of 42 hospitals that service every state and territory. We create jobs for over 19,000 people and provide work for nearly as many accredited medical practitioners. Together each year they manage 600,000 hospital admissions, 75,000 emergency room presentations and deliver 12,000 newborns.
